Definitions
eponychium
NounUK
/ˌɛpəˈnɪkɪəm/
US
/ˌɛpəˈnɪkiəm/
The thickened layer of skin surrounding fingernails and toenails, also known as the cuticle.
The eponychium helps protect the nail bed from bacteria and infection.
